## Deployment

Audio-guide app for the Veldhuis Gallery. Build the backend image, push to the staging registry, run migrations, then cut traffic over via the Lanternby proxy. Exhibit audio assets sync from the curator bucket on a fifteen-minute cycle; don't trigger a manual sync during open hours. Smoke-test tour playback on at least one handset before promoting. The service starts with the following configuration:

config for kafof-bawef:
holath:
  log_level: debug
  metrics_host: metrics.holath.qorvelsys.internal
  pin: 2191
  pool_size: 32

## Releases

Scrubshot releases ship weekly. Every build runs the EXIF-scrub regression suite; images with surviving GPS or device tags block the release. Tag the commit, run `make release`, verify the scrub report is clean, then upload artifacts. All artifacts must be signed — unsigned builds are rejected by the distribution mirror. New team members: add the release signing key to your keyring before your first cut. The key is:

rollout seal: bky4_yke3

Night shift — from the front desk at Danver Mill. Quick notes for tonight. Bike cage: latch is sticking again, give the gate a firm push after locking; contractor comes Thursday. Parking gates: the east gate is stuck open, barrier arm removed, so log any vehicles manually. West gate works normally. Do a walk-past of the cage around 02:00. If you need to open the west gate or cage manually, use the code below.

door code, yagag-yajog: bdg-PO-2

Ticket for eng sync: Driftpane's diff viewer chokes on files over about 50k lines — the side-by-side view renders fine, but scrolling stutters badly and the minimap just gives up. Tomas thinks it's the syntax highlighter re-tokenizing the whole file on every scroll event. Smaller files are fine, so it's clearly a scaling thing, not a parsing bug. Repro: open any generated lockfile from the Harrowgate monorepo and scroll fast. The build where we first caught it is below.

session token of tajef-bageg = htk21_5d90d574934f3ccae6437